| WordNet: Chinese anise |
The noun has 2 meanings:
Meaning #1:
small tree of China and Vietnam bearing anise-scented star-shaped fruit used in food and medicinally as a carminative
Synonyms: star anise, Illicium verum
Meaning #2:
anise-scented star-shaped fruit or seed used in Oriental cooking and medicine
Synonyms: star anise, star aniseed
